2. Venue control
The venue controls its accounts, eligibility, market listing, order book, fees, outages, suspensions, custody, trading, settlement, challenges, withdrawals, and records. Zavit holds no venue funds and transmits no production orders in this launch.
3. Normalization limits
Zavit may normalize titles, probabilities, categories, timestamps, balances, positions, or fills to make venues easier to compare. Normalization can hide meaningful differences. Contracts with similar names may use different cutoffs, sources, exclusions, fees, payout structures, or resolution procedures and are not necessarily interchangeable or arbitrage equivalents.
4. Data quality and timing
Data can be delayed, cached, revised, unavailable, or inconsistent with a venue-native screen. A displayed price may not be executable for any size. Check the source label and timestamp and verify important information at the venue.
